Imagine that you are doing a project on what spheres of work are teenagers interested in. You have collected some data on the subject—the results of the opinion polls (see the table below).

Comment on the data in the table and give your personal opinion on the subject of the project.

Spheres

Number of teenagers (%)

IT sphere

63

Financial sphere

62

Coaching

35

Blogging

26

Teaching

10

Write 200–250 words. Use the following plan:

  • make an opening statement on the subject of the project work;
  • select and report 2–3 main features;
  • make 1–2 comparisons where relevant;
  • outline a problem that can arise with the teenagers' choice and suggest the way of solving it;
  • draw a conclusion giving your personal opinion on the results of such choice.

Imagine that you are doing a project on what plans teenagers have after graduating from school. You have collected some data on the subject—the results of the opinion polls (see the diagram below).

Comment on the data in the diagram and give your personal opinion on the subject of the project.

Write 200–250 words. Use the following plan:

  • make an opening statement on the subject of the project work;
  • select and report 2–3 main features;
  • make 1–2 comparisons where relevant;
  • outline a problem that can arise with teenagers' preferences and suggest the way of solving it;
  • draw a conclusion giving your personal opinion on the importance of free time activities in teenagers' lives.
